Sensex cracked around 700 points, Bank Nifty tumbled more than 1000 points; Financial services and Banks were draggers of the day

TITAN, Maruti Suzuki and Ultratech cement are the top gainers while HDFC Bank, HDFC and IndusInd bank were the top losers amongst Nifty 50 stocks

DSIJ Intelligence 0 2794 Article rating: 4.8

Indices witnessed strong profit booking session led by index heavyweight stocks because of MSCI adjustment factor. Nifty cracked 186 points to close 1 per cent lower at 18,069 level.  S&P BSE Sensex dropped more than 700 points and closed at 61,054 level. Nifty Midcap 100 and Nifty Small cap 100 also traded weak for the day to close around 0.70 per cent and 0.82 per cent lower respectively.

Sentiment Indicators

Ninad Ramdasi 0 51 Article rating: 5.0

This indicator measures the percentage of Nifty 50 stocks that are trading above/below their 200-day simple moving averages. The 200-DMA is considered important as it is one of the basic technical indicators that can be used to determine the long-term trend of a security.

Sensex jumped 555 points; Nifty witnessed strong short covering on weekly expiry, Financial services and PSU Banks emerged as pullers of the day

Bajaj Finance, HDFC Life and SBI Life were the top gainers while UPL, Nestle and IndusInd bank were the top losers amongst Nifty 50 stocks. 

DSIJ Intelligence 0 906 Article rating: 5.0

Nifty rallied one way after the gap down opening because of global cues. The strong results of index heavy weight stocks like HDFC, Adani enterprises triggered short covering. S&P BSE Sensex jumped 555 points and closed at 61,749 level. Nifty Midcap 100 and Nifty Small cap 100 traded strong for the day to close around 0.58 per cent and 0.79 per cent higher respectively.
